Apple Fritter Bites Recipe

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1/4 cup sugar
  • 1 1/2 tsp baking powder
  • 1/2 tsp cinnamon
  • 1/4 tsp salt
  • 1/2 cup milk
  • 1 large egg
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• 1 cup finely chopped apples (preferably Granny Smith)
  • Oil for frying
  • Powdered sugar for dusting

Instructions

  • In a bowl, whisk together flour, sugar, baking powder, cinnamon, and salt.
  • In another bowl, mix milk, egg, and vanilla extract. Gradually add the wet mixture to the dry ingredients, stirring until just combined.
  • Fold in the chopped apples.
  • Heat oil in a deep skillet to 350°F (175°C).
  • Drop small spoonfuls of batter into the hot oil and fry for 2-3 minutes, or until golden brown.
  • Remove fritters from oil, drain on paper towels, and dust with powdered sugar before serving.

Notes

  • Use firm apples like Granny Smith for a balanced sweet-tart flavor.
  • Avoid overcrowding the skillet to ensure even cooking.
  • Best served warm but can be stored in an airtight container for up to 2 days.
